How to Discover a More Exciting Life

Here are some steps you can try to change your life:

Step #1: Think of your life as a story. If it were a book, would you flip from one page to the next eager to find out what happens? Is it a book you would read with bated breath? If it’s a rather dull book, then maybe it’s time to write another one. What does your life story really say about you?

Step #2: If your life is not a page-turner, you need some clarity. Do you like where you live? Do you like the people in your life? Do you like the work that you do? Make a list of all the things you like and all the things that you would like to be different.

Step #3: Figure out what to keep and what to leave behind. If you dread spending time with your friends, then you need new friends. If you hate going to work, then you need to find another way of making a living. Think about what to drop and what to add to your life. Think about what to stop and what to start. As you think in this way, you’ll come up with a plan of escape.

Step #4: Do something about your plan.Put your goals into action. Make it happen. If you need things to be different, you have to be different. You have to think, feel and live in a different way. For all this to happen, you have to take action. Fight for your dreams, and dream about a happier life.

Step #5: Stop trying to improve yourself. If you think you need to change yourself, it means you feel you’re not good enough. Also, quit trying to impress other people. This also signals a sense of inferiority. You won’t go far if you keep disapproving of yourself. Sure, work on learning new skills and getting better at doing things, but do it from a place where you first accept yourself as you are. It’s not about fixing something; you’re not broken. It’s more about expressing more of yourself.

Step #6: Move to a place where you can start over. It may be to another house in your neighborhood. It may be to another town. It may be to another state. It may even be to another country. Your Ultimate Goal

Your ultimate goal is not just to change your life and make it more exciting. It’s much bigger and grander than that.

Your goal is to hunt for a life worth living.

How you define a good life depends on your ideals. The important thing is to quit living out a life that you inherited. Quit living out of your past.

Instead, invent a life that thrills you.

What if you could create a life that you loved? What if you didn’t need to go on a vacation to escape your life?

Your ultimate goal, then, is to be more yourself. When you’re more yourself, you’ll be happier. What is happiness, anyway? Mahatma Gandhi had a good grasp of the concept. He said, “Happiness is when what you think, what you say, and what you do are in harmony.”
